island-hop

From Wiktionary, the free dictionary
Jump to navigation Jump to search

English[edit]

Verb[edit]

island-hop (third-person singular simple present island-hops, present participle island-hopping, simple past and past participle island-hopped)

  1. (intransitive) To travel from island to island in a certain area, especially as a tourist to visit numerous islands.
